Transaction 0702dbe83da4bf51189026a588d3d0715b077215c6f990bc4c8b03f85cd301bf
1 Input
1 Output
-
0702dbe83da4bf51189026a588d3d0715b077215c6f990bc4c8b03f85cd301bf:0
- value
- 159405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b039a13172970216ba3a412d8caad291844754c OP_EQUAL
- address
- 3QaFqxJnL3RhDQiwvYeqHeAgdAUh4AgCUQ